Home
last modified time | relevance | path

Searched refs:domain (Results 1 – 25 of 192) sorted by relevance

12345678

/arch/arm/boot/dts/
Dkeystone-k2hk-clocks.dtsi59 reg-names = "control", "domain";
60 domain-id = <0>;
69 reg-names = "control", "domain";
70 domain-id = <4>;
79 reg-names = "control", "domain";
80 domain-id = <5>;
89 reg-names = "control", "domain";
90 domain-id = <9>;
99 reg-names = "control", "domain";
100 domain-id = <10>;
[all …]
Dkeystone-k2l-clocks.dtsi49 reg-names = "control", "domain";
51 domain-id = <0>;
60 reg-names = "control", "domain";
61 domain-id = <4>;
70 reg-names = "control", "domain";
71 domain-id = <9>;
80 reg-names = "control", "domain";
81 domain-id = <10>;
90 reg-names = "control", "domain";
91 domain-id = <11>;
[all …]
Dkeystone-clocks.dtsi166 reg-names = "control", "domain";
167 domain-id = <0>;
177 reg-names = "control", "domain";
178 domain-id = <0>;
187 reg-names = "control", "domain";
188 domain-id = <0>;
198 reg-names = "control", "domain";
199 domain-id = <1>;
208 reg-names = "control", "domain";
209 domain-id = <1>;
[all …]
Dkeystone-k2e-clocks.dtsi41 reg-names = "control", "domain";
42 domain-id = <0>;
51 reg-names = "control", "domain";
52 domain-id = <5>;
61 reg-names = "control", "domain";
62 domain-id = <18>;
71 reg-names = "control", "domain";
72 domain-id = <29>;
/arch/ia64/kernel/
Dirq_ia64.c79 .domain = CPU_MASK_NONE
105 static inline int find_unassigned_vector(cpumask_t domain) in find_unassigned_vector() argument
110 cpumask_and(&mask, &domain, cpu_online_mask); in find_unassigned_vector()
116 cpumask_and(&mask, &domain, &vector_table[vector]); in find_unassigned_vector()
124 static int __bind_irq_vector(int irq, int vector, cpumask_t domain) in __bind_irq_vector() argument
133 cpumask_and(&mask, &domain, cpu_online_mask); in __bind_irq_vector()
136 if ((cfg->vector == vector) && cpumask_equal(&cfg->domain, &domain)) in __bind_irq_vector()
143 cfg->domain = domain; in __bind_irq_vector()
145 cpumask_or(&vector_table[vector], &vector_table[vector], &domain); in __bind_irq_vector()
149 int bind_irq_vector(int irq, int vector, cpumask_t domain) in bind_irq_vector() argument
[all …]
/arch/x86/include/asm/
Dirqdomain.h42 extern int mp_irqdomain_alloc(struct irq_domain *domain, unsigned int virq,
44 extern void mp_irqdomain_free(struct irq_domain *domain, unsigned int virq,
46 extern int mp_irqdomain_activate(struct irq_domain *domain,
48 extern void mp_irqdomain_deactivate(struct irq_domain *domain,
50 extern int mp_irqdomain_ioapic_idx(struct irq_domain *domain);
54 extern void arch_init_msi_domain(struct irq_domain *domain);
56 static inline void arch_init_msi_domain(struct irq_domain *domain) { } in arch_init_msi_domain() argument
Ddevice.h20 void add_dma_domain(struct dma_domain *domain);
21 void del_dma_domain(struct dma_domain *domain);
/arch/arm/include/asm/
Ddomain.h87 unsigned int domain; in get_domain() local
91 : "=r" (domain) in get_domain()
94 return domain; in get_domain()
118 unsigned int domain = get_domain(); \
119 domain &= ~domain_mask(dom); \
120 domain = domain | domain_val(dom, type); \
121 set_domain(domain); \
/arch/mips/sgi-ip27/
Dip27-irq.c118 static int hub_domain_alloc(struct irq_domain *domain, unsigned int virq, in hub_domain_alloc() argument
139 irq_domain_set_info(domain, virq, swlevel, &hub_irq_type, hd, in hub_domain_alloc()
157 static void hub_domain_free(struct irq_domain *domain, in hub_domain_free() argument
165 irqd = irq_domain_get_irq_data(domain, virq); in hub_domain_free()
191 struct irq_domain *domain; in ip27_do_irq_mask0() local
218 domain = irq_desc_get_handler_data(desc); in ip27_do_irq_mask0()
219 irq = irq_linear_revmap(domain, __ffs(pend0)); in ip27_do_irq_mask0()
233 struct irq_domain *domain; in ip27_do_irq_mask1() local
244 domain = irq_desc_get_handler_data(desc); in ip27_do_irq_mask1()
245 irq = irq_linear_revmap(domain, __ffs(pend1) + 64); in ip27_do_irq_mask1()
[all …]
/arch/powerpc/platforms/powernv/
Dopal-imc.c149 static struct imc_pmu *imc_pmu_create(struct device_node *parent, int pmu_index, int domain) in imc_pmu_create() argument
156 if (domain < 0) in imc_pmu_create()
165 pmu_ptr->domain = domain; in imc_pmu_create()
181 if (pmu_ptr->domain == IMC_DOMAIN_NEST) in imc_pmu_create()
249 int pmu_count = 0, domain; in opal_imc_counters_probe() local
272 domain = IMC_DOMAIN_NEST; in opal_imc_counters_probe()
275 domain =IMC_DOMAIN_CORE; in opal_imc_counters_probe()
278 domain = IMC_DOMAIN_THREAD; in opal_imc_counters_probe()
288 domain = -1; in opal_imc_counters_probe()
292 domain = -1; in opal_imc_counters_probe()
[all …]
/arch/x86/platform/uv/
Duv_irq.c75 static int uv_domain_alloc(struct irq_domain *domain, unsigned int virq, in uv_domain_alloc() argument
80 struct irq_data *irq_data = irq_domain_get_irq_data(domain, virq); in uv_domain_alloc()
91 ret = irq_domain_alloc_irqs_parent(domain, virq, nr_irqs, arg); in uv_domain_alloc()
100 irq_domain_set_info(domain, virq, virq, &uv_irq_chip, chip_data, in uv_domain_alloc()
109 static void uv_domain_free(struct irq_domain *domain, unsigned int virq, in uv_domain_free() argument
112 struct irq_data *irq_data = irq_domain_get_irq_data(domain, virq); in uv_domain_free()
118 irq_domain_free_irqs_top(domain, virq, nr_irqs); in uv_domain_free()
125 static int uv_domain_activate(struct irq_domain *domain, in uv_domain_activate() argument
136 static void uv_domain_deactivate(struct irq_domain *domain, in uv_domain_deactivate() argument
189 struct irq_domain *domain = uv_get_irq_domain(); in uv_setup_irq() local
[all …]
/arch/x86/kernel/apic/
Dmsi.c189 struct irq_domain *domain; in native_setup_msi_irqs() local
196 domain = irq_remapping_get_irq_domain(&info); in native_setup_msi_irqs()
197 if (domain == NULL) in native_setup_msi_irqs()
198 domain = msi_default_domain; in native_setup_msi_irqs()
199 if (domain == NULL) in native_setup_msi_irqs()
202 return msi_domain_alloc_irqs(domain, &dev->dev, nvec); in native_setup_msi_irqs()
216 int pci_msi_prepare(struct irq_domain *domain, struct device *dev, int nvec, in pci_msi_prepare() argument
339 static int dmar_msi_init(struct irq_domain *domain, in dmar_msi_init() argument
343 irq_domain_set_info(domain, virq, arg->dmar_id, info->chip, NULL, in dmar_msi_init()
383 struct irq_domain *domain = dmar_get_irq_domain(); in dmar_alloc_hwirq() local
[all …]
/arch/mips/ralink/
Dirq.c102 struct irq_domain *domain = irq_desc_get_handler_data(desc); in ralink_intc_irq_handler() local
103 generic_handle_irq(irq_find_mapping(domain, __ffs(pending))); in ralink_intc_irq_handler()
150 struct irq_domain *domain; in intc_of_init() local
179 domain = irq_domain_add_legacy(node, RALINK_INTC_IRQ_COUNT, in intc_of_init()
181 if (!domain) in intc_of_init()
186 irq_set_chained_handler_and_data(irq, ralink_intc_irq_handler, domain); in intc_of_init()
189 rt_perfcount_irq = irq_create_mapping(domain, 9); in intc_of_init()
/arch/x86/pci/
Dacpi.c200 seg = info->sd.domain; in setup_mcfg_map()
229 pci_mmconfig_delete(info->sd.domain, in teardown_mcfg_map()
328 int domain = root->segment; in pci_acpi_scan_root() local
334 root->segment = domain = 0; in pci_acpi_scan_root()
336 if (domain && !pci_domains_supported) { in pci_acpi_scan_root()
339 domain, busnum); in pci_acpi_scan_root()
343 bus = pci_find_bus(domain, busnum); in pci_acpi_scan_root()
350 .domain = domain, in pci_acpi_scan_root()
363 domain, busnum); in pci_acpi_scan_root()
365 info->sd.domain = domain; in pci_acpi_scan_root()
Dcommon.c39 int raw_pci_read(unsigned int domain, unsigned int bus, unsigned int devfn, in raw_pci_read() argument
42 if (domain == 0 && reg < 256 && raw_pci_ops) in raw_pci_read()
43 return raw_pci_ops->read(domain, bus, devfn, reg, len, val); in raw_pci_read()
45 return raw_pci_ext_ops->read(domain, bus, devfn, reg, len, val); in raw_pci_read()
49 int raw_pci_write(unsigned int domain, unsigned int bus, unsigned int devfn, in raw_pci_write() argument
52 if (domain == 0 && reg < 256 && raw_pci_ops) in raw_pci_write()
53 return raw_pci_ops->write(domain, bus, devfn, reg, len, val); in raw_pci_write()
55 return raw_pci_ext_ops->write(domain, bus, devfn, reg, len, val); in raw_pci_write()
632 void add_dma_domain(struct dma_domain *domain) in add_dma_domain() argument
635 list_add(&domain->node, &dma_domain_list); in add_dma_domain()
[all …]
/arch/powerpc/perf/
Dhv-24x7.c33 static bool domain_is_valid(unsigned domain) in domain_is_valid() argument
35 switch (domain) { in domain_is_valid()
47 static bool is_physical_domain(unsigned domain) in is_physical_domain() argument
49 switch (domain) { in is_physical_domain()
61 static bool domain_needs_aggregation(unsigned int domain) in domain_needs_aggregation() argument
64 (domain == HV_PERF_DOMAIN_PHYS_CORE || in domain_needs_aggregation()
65 (domain >= HV_PERF_DOMAIN_VCPU_HOME_CORE && in domain_needs_aggregation()
66 domain <= HV_PERF_DOMAIN_VCPU_REMOTE_NODE)); in domain_needs_aggregation()
69 static const char *domain_name(unsigned domain) in domain_name() argument
71 if (!domain_is_valid(domain)) in domain_name()
[all …]
/arch/nios2/kernel/
Dirq.c64 struct irq_domain *domain; in init_IRQ() local
73 domain = irq_domain_add_linear(node, NIOS2_CPU_NR_IRQS, &irq_ops, NULL); in init_IRQ()
74 BUG_ON(!domain); in init_IRQ()
76 irq_set_default_host(domain); in init_IRQ()
/arch/s390/include/uapi/asm/
Dpkey.h69 __u16 domain; member
94 __u16 domain; /* in: domain or FFFF for any */ member
105 __u16 domain; /* in: domain or FFFF for any */ member
117 __u16 domain; /* in: domain or FFFF for any */ member
140 __u16 domain; /* out: domain number */ member
164 __u16 domain; /* out: domain number */ member
286 __u16 domain; /* in/out: domain number */ member
/arch/mips/pci/
Dpci-xtalk-bridge.c306 static int bridge_domain_alloc(struct irq_domain *domain, unsigned int virq, in bridge_domain_alloc() argument
320 ret = irq_domain_alloc_irqs_parent(domain, virq, nr_irqs, arg); in bridge_domain_alloc()
324 irq_domain_set_info(domain, virq, info->pin, &bridge_irq_chip, in bridge_domain_alloc()
333 static void bridge_domain_free(struct irq_domain *domain, unsigned int virq, in bridge_domain_free() argument
336 struct irq_data *irqd = irq_domain_get_irq_data(domain, virq); in bridge_domain_free()
342 irq_domain_free_irqs_top(domain, virq, nr_irqs); in bridge_domain_free()
345 static int bridge_domain_activate(struct irq_domain *domain, in bridge_domain_activate() argument
382 static void bridge_domain_deactivate(struct irq_domain *domain, in bridge_domain_deactivate() argument
419 irq = irq_domain_alloc_irqs(bc->domain, 1, bc->nasid, &info); in bridge_map_irq()
434 struct irq_domain *domain, *parent; in bridge_probe() local
[all …]
/arch/arm/mm/
Ddump.c255 unsigned int level, u64 val, const char *domain) in note_page() argument
263 st->current_domain = domain; in note_page()
266 domain != st->current_domain || in note_page()
297 st->current_domain = domain; in note_page()
303 const char *domain) in walk_pte() argument
311 note_page(st, addr, 4, pte_val(*pte), domain); in walk_pte()
339 const char *domain; in walk_pmd() local
343 domain = get_domain_name(pmd); in walk_pmd()
345 note_page(st, addr, 3, pmd_val(*pmd), domain); in walk_pmd()
347 walk_pte(st, pmd, addr, domain); in walk_pmd()
[all …]
/arch/mips/ath25/
Dar2315.c79 struct irq_domain *domain = irq_desc_get_handler_data(desc); in ar2315_misc_irq_handler() local
82 misc_irq = irq_find_mapping(domain, nr); in ar2315_misc_irq_handler()
151 struct irq_domain *domain; in ar2315_arch_init_irq() local
156 domain = irq_domain_add_linear(NULL, AR2315_MISC_IRQ_COUNT, in ar2315_arch_init_irq()
158 if (!domain) in ar2315_arch_init_irq()
161 irq = irq_create_mapping(domain, AR2315_MISC_IRQ_AHB); in ar2315_arch_init_irq()
165 ar2315_misc_irq_handler, domain); in ar2315_arch_init_irq()
167 ar2315_misc_irq_domain = domain; in ar2315_arch_init_irq()
Dar5312.c83 struct irq_domain *domain = irq_desc_get_handler_data(desc); in ar5312_misc_irq_handler() local
86 misc_irq = irq_find_mapping(domain, nr); in ar5312_misc_irq_handler()
146 struct irq_domain *domain; in ar5312_arch_init_irq() local
151 domain = irq_domain_add_linear(NULL, AR5312_MISC_IRQ_COUNT, in ar5312_arch_init_irq()
153 if (!domain) in ar5312_arch_init_irq()
156 irq = irq_create_mapping(domain, AR5312_MISC_IRQ_AHB_PROC); in ar5312_arch_init_irq()
160 ar5312_misc_irq_handler, domain); in ar5312_arch_init_irq()
162 ar5312_misc_irq_domain = domain; in ar5312_arch_init_irq()
/arch/arm/mach-zx/
Dzx296702-pm-domain.c38 static int normal_power_off(struct generic_pm_domain *domain) in normal_power_off() argument
40 struct zx_pm_domain *zpd = (struct zx_pm_domain *)domain; in normal_power_off()
67 pr_err("Error: %s %s fail\n", __func__, domain->name); in normal_power_off()
74 static int normal_power_on(struct generic_pm_domain *domain) in normal_power_on() argument
76 struct zx_pm_domain *zpd = (struct zx_pm_domain *)domain; in normal_power_on()
88 pr_err("Error: %s %s fail\n", __func__, domain->name); in normal_power_on()
/arch/arm/mach-imx/
D3ds_debugboard.c57 static struct irq_domain *domain; variable
98 generic_handle_irq(irq_find_mapping(domain, expio_irq)); in mxc_expio_irq_handler()
186 domain = irq_domain_add_legacy(NULL, MXC_MAX_EXP_IO_LINES, irq_base, 0, in mxc_expio_init()
188 WARN_ON(!domain); in mxc_expio_init()
202 smsc911x_resources[1].start = irq_find_mapping(domain, EXPIO_INT_ENET); in mxc_expio_init()
203 smsc911x_resources[1].end = irq_find_mapping(domain, EXPIO_INT_ENET); in mxc_expio_init()
Dgpc.c194 static int imx_gpc_domain_alloc(struct irq_domain *domain, in imx_gpc_domain_alloc() argument
213 irq_domain_set_hwirq_and_chip(domain, irq + i, hwirq + i, in imx_gpc_domain_alloc()
217 parent_fwspec.fwnode = domain->parent->fwnode; in imx_gpc_domain_alloc()
218 return irq_domain_alloc_irqs_parent(domain, irq, nr_irqs, in imx_gpc_domain_alloc()
231 struct irq_domain *parent_domain, *domain; in imx_gpc_init() local
249 domain = irq_domain_add_hierarchy(parent_domain, 0, GPC_MAX_IRQS, in imx_gpc_init()
252 if (!domain) { in imx_gpc_init()

12345678